Description

Brick ranch just minutes from downtown Carrboro! Located in an established neighborhood. Incredible potential with a functional layout and unfinished basement ready for expansion or storage. Major updates already completed including a new roof (2025), newer HVAC, and newer water heater. The home features a double gravel driveway and garage. Near downtown Carrboro, UNC, and Chapel Hill, this is a rare opportunity for investors or buyers ready to renovate and build equity.
107 Aberdeen Ct, Carrboro, NC 27510 is a 3 bedroom, 2 bathroom, 1,817 sqft single-family home built in 1977. It last sold for $505,000 on Apr 6, 2026 (3% above the $490,000 asking price). It is currently off market. The Trulia Estimate is $497,500, with a rent estimate of $2,422/month.
